> Log:
>  Introduce the option VFS_ALLOW_NONMPSAFE and turn it on by default on
>  all the architectures.
>  The option allows to mount non-MPSAFE filesystem. Without it, the
>  kernel will refuse to mount a non-MPSAFE filesytem.
>
>  This patch is part of the effort of killing non-MPSAFE filesystems
>  from the tree.

This is just a gentle reminder in order to point you further to the
"official" page:
http://wiki.freebsd.org/NONMPSAFE_DEORBIT_VFS

and encourage once again people in adopting a dying FS if it really
matters to them.
So far, unfortunately, I didn't see a lot of activity in this area but
I hope that this would change soon.
